Embodiment Construction

[0019] The present invention is composed of a signal processing module, an audio output module, a display module, a communication module, a control module and a main control module;

[0020] Signal processing module: use Butterworth 2nd-order low-pass filter, chip U1 is OP07 operational amplifier integrated circuit, filter and amplify the input signal.

[0021] The signal is input from Vin, connected in series with resistor R1, resistor R3, capacitor C2, and capacitor C4, and then connected to the input from pin 3 of chip U2 and output from pin 6. R3 is connected in parallel with capacitor C1 to the output terminal, and R2 is connected in parallel to ground. C4 connects R4 in parallel to the output terminal, and connects C3 in parallel to ground. Pin 3 in parallel with R5. The output terminal is connected to U2 pin 2 after connecting R7 in parallel, and grounding after connecting R6 and R7. Pin 7 of U2 is connected to +5V voltage, and pin 4 is connected to -5V voltage.

Abstract

The invention discloses a multi-fetus heartbeat and movement monitor based on a wireless protocol, belongs to the technical field of electronics, and aims at providing the heartbeat and movement monitor which is not only oriented to single-fetus pregnant women, can also be more conveniently used for dual-fetus or multi-fetus pregnant women, and is provided with a replaceable ultrasonic probe and based on the wireless protocol.The multi-fetus heartbeat and movement monitor is composed of a signal processing module, an audio output module, a display module, a communication module, a control module and a main control module.Fetal heartbeat and movement monitoring service based on the wireless protocol can be more conveniently and accurately provided for dual-fetus or multi-fetus pregnant women.Heartbeat and movement information of two or more fetuses can be obtained from multiple signals at the same time, the multi-fetus heartbeat and movement monitor can be conveniently used for dual-fetus or multi-fetus pregnant women, and meanwhile single-fetus pregnant women can obtain more accurate data.

Description

technical field [0001] The invention belongs to the field of electronic technology. Background technique [0002] At present, the fetal heart rate and fetal movement monitor has been widely used in the field of clinical and home monitoring. It is used by pregnant women to monitor the heart rate of the fetus in the pregnant woman's abdomen anytime and anywhere, and enables doctors to know the status of pregnant women at any time, which is convenient for doctors and patients. communicate. Existing fetal heart rate and fetal movement monitors are generally considered for singleton pregnant women, while twin and multiple pregnancy pregnant women have inconvenience in use, and the fetal heart rate data obtained are not accurate enough. And after giving birth, the pregnant woman no longer needs the fetal heart rate and fetal movement monitor, resulting in a waste of resources.
